Charlestown's Schools

  • EARN 60+ college credits while in high school.
  • CHS students can earn a Statewide Transfer General Education Core allowing students to start their college education as a sophomore.
  • 7 Advanced Placement courses and various rigorous curricula to explore career interests and to prepare students for postsecondary opportunities.
  • Award-winning programs in fine arts, radio/TV, and more.
  • Competitive sports programs with state-of-the-art athletic facilities including an artificial turf football field, modern tennis complex, new locker room and concession stand.
  • Get involved in one of the school’s many extra curricular activities, including football, marching band, archery, wrestling, theater and more.

Jeffersonville's Schools

  • FREE COLLEGE for Jeffersonville High School students after graduation as part of Jeffersonville’s Promise (non-residents may participate).
  • Nationally recognized as a Project Lead the Way Distinguished School.
  • EARN 60+ college credits while in high school.
  • JHS students can earn a Statewide Transfer General Education Core allowing students to start their college education as a sophomore.
  • 13 Advanced Placement courses and various rigorous curricula to explore career interests and to prepare students for postsecondary opportunities.
  • Award-winning programs in theater, band, JROTC, radio/TV and more.
  • State-of-the-art athletic facilities including artificial turf football, baseball, and softball fields.
  • A new tennis complex with 12-lighted courts plus a locker room, concession stand, and meeting room.
  • Discover interests through clubs and activities, including BAYA (Beautiful As You Are), elementary robotics, Anchor Club, Step Team, elementary chess and more.
  • Pursue a variety of sports, including football, basketball, wrestling, archery, swimming, bowling, volleyball and more.

Highest Graduation Rate in Region

Greater Clark County Schools is proud to claim the highest graduation rates in our region.
Greater Clark County Schools: 93.05%

Borden-Henryville School Corp.: 89.09%

Clarksville Community Schools: 65.34%

New Albany Floyd County Schools: 84.73%

Scott County Schools District 2: 85.16%

Silver Creek School Corp.: 92.76%

Southwestern-Jefferson Consolidated Schools: 83.95%

*Class of 2023 Non-Waiver Graduation Rates

Earning College Credits

Total Dual Credits Earned for the Class of 2023

Charlestown High School 3,449

Jeffersonville High School 7,694

New Washington High School 1,181

Total Dual Credits Earned by GCCS Class of 2023: 12,324
That’s a Savings of $ 2,464,800*
*Calculate 12,324 credits by $200/credit hour
